Handover: KeyMill rotation utility

Hey folks — passing KeyMill over to Darya while I'm out. Quick status: the cron-based rotation for the Pattern staging vaults is solid, but the prod rollout is paused until the dual-write check lands. If a rotation fails, it retries three times then pages #keymill-oncall. Don't manually rotate the billing creds; that path still has the stale-cache bug from sprint 14. Darya, the config flags and the deferred-rotation queue are documented on the internal wiki page here.

dashboard of kafop-yagep = https://jira.zemvarsys.internal/pages/pages/pages/display/cc87

# Environments: PinPoint Autocomplete

Three environments: dev, staging, prod. Dev resets nightly. Staging mirrors prod data minus the Harwick dataset. Promotions go dev → staging → prod; no direct prod pushes. Staging smoke tests must pass before release sign-off. Prod config is locked behind change review. Current staging values are as follows.

settings of kafop-fahog:
PRAWYN_PIN=8793
PRAWYN_METRICS_HOST=metrics.prawyn.lumiccorp.corp
PRAWYN_LOG_LEVEL=warn
PRAWYN_TENANT=kasox

## Deploying the Gatewick Proctor Queue

Deploys are pretty painless: push to main, wait for the pipeline, then watch the queue drain dashboard for five minutes. If candidates pile up mid-exam, roll back first and ask questions later — the queue replays safely. Everything the workers care about lives in one config block, shown here for reference.

settings of bafof-yagef:
JOROX_PIN=8740
JOROX_TENANT=pelox
JOROX_METRICS_HOST=metrics.jorox.qorvelworks.internal
JOROX_SEAL=seal_c78f63c1
JOROX_STANDBY_TEAM=norax

TICKET QX-2241: Intermittent connection failures under per-tenant rate quotas

Since enabling quota enforcement in Meterline, tenants exceeding their burst allowance are having pooled connections dropped mid-transaction rather than queued. Future maintainers: the quota gate sits in front of the pooler, so retries must be idempotent. We reproduced the failure reliably against the staging quota database. For verification, connect to that staging instance using the string below.

replica DSN, kajep-yahag: mssql://praok_svc:iF@db-8d68.plorvaio.local:5432/eliion